It only eliminates high FODMAP foods and can be individualized, so you … Web8 okt. 2024 · Most Common GERD Symptoms. The most common symptoms of GERD tend to be burning and discomfort in the stomach and throat, nausea, vomiting, coughing and belching, chest pain, difficulty swallowing and/or laryngitis. Web3 aug. 2024 · The term FODMAP is an acronym for: Fermentable Oligosaccharides Disaccharides Monosaccharides And Polyols. These are found in wheat, onions, garlic, milk, legumes, high fructose corn syrup, apples and many other foods.
